Espresso: The Strong Traditional



Coffee personifies the essence of coffee's abundant tradition, offering a vibrant and concentrated experience that captivates fanatics worldwide. Stemming from Italy in the very early 20th century, espresso is created by compeling warm water via finely-ground coffee under high stress (Brooklyn Coffee Shops). This method results in a small, extreme shot of coffee that is both tasty and aromatic, defined by a rich crema that bases on its surface




The flavor account of espresso is complex, often exhibiting notes of chocolate, caramel, and various fruit touches, relying on the bean origin and roast degree. This concentrated form of coffee acts as the structure for numerous popular drinks, such as cappuccinos, lattes, and macchiatos. Each of these beverages showcases the convenience of espresso, permitting for various appearances and tastes with the addition of milk or foam.


Coffee is not just valued for its preference yet likewise for its social value. In Italy, it is usual to delight in a quick chance at the bar, emphasizing the social facet of coffee usage. As worldwide gratitude for coffee remains to expand, it continues to be a keystone of coffee culture, showing both practice and development in its preparation and discussion.


Drip Coffee: Everyday Brew



Drip coffee, usually considered the ultimate day-to-day brew, is a staple in offices and homes alike. Understood for its uncomplicated preparation and regular results, drip coffee is made by brewing ground coffee with warm water that travels through a filter. This technique removes the coffee's vital flavors and fragrances, making it a recommended option for several.




One of the defining features of drip coffee is its adaptability in flavor profiles (Coffee Shops).Drip coffee machines additionally permit for customization, with options such as brew stamina settings and programmable timers. Whether taken pleasure in black or with included cream and sugar, drip coffee stays a cherished choice for its balance of flavor, access, and ease.


Cold Brew: Smooth and Rejuvenating



Cold brew coffee's special prep work technique uses a refreshing option to typical brewing strategies. Unlike standard brewing approaches that utilize hot water, cool brew utilizes a soaking process that entails coarsely ground coffee soaked in chilly or area temperature water for an extended duration, normally 12 to 24 hours. This technique not only draws out the coffee's flavors but likewise lessens acidity, resulting in a smoother and much more smooth mug.


The taste account of cold mixture is identified by its sweet, chocolatey notes, typically accompanied by refined hints of caramel and nutty undertones. This gentler removal process protects the all-natural oils and aromas of the coffee beans, bring about a abundant and robust experience. Cold mixture can be enjoyed by itself or watered down with milk or a non-dairy choice, enabling adaptability in preference.


Additionally, cool brew is commonly offered over ice, making it a suitable selection for cozy weather condition. Its refreshing nature has actually gathered popularity amongst coffee enthusiasts, supplying a delightful method to enjoy caffeine without the anger usually connected with hotter mixtures. Therefore, chilly mixture represents a substantial development in coffee prep work and satisfaction.

French Press: Rich and Robust



Accepting a time-honored developing method, the French press delivers a abundant and robust coffee experience that attract enthusiasts and casual enthusiasts alike. This technique involves steeping crude coffee premises in warm water, allowing the complete range of oils and tastes to infuse into the mixture. The result is a mug of coffee characterized by its deep, full-bodied flavor and a thick, velvety mouthfeel.


One of the defining attributes of French press coffee is its capacity blog here to highlight the all-natural attributes of the beans. The immersion brewing method enables for optimum removal, resulting in an intricate flavor profile that can range from earthy and chocolatey to intense and fruity, relying on the origin of the coffee. Additionally, the lack of paper filters keeps the essential oils, boosting the richness of the brew.


To prepare a French press, one should consider the coffee-to-water ratio, grind dimension, and steeping time. Usually, a coarser grind is advised to stop over-extraction, while a steeping time of 4 mins strikes the best balance in between taste and level of smoothness. Eventually, the French press provides a personalized and immersive coffee experience, making it a valued choice for several.


Specialized Coffees: One-of-a-kind Blends



Discovering the world of specialized coffees reveals a vibrant array of unique blends that deal with diverse tastes and choices. Specialized coffees are defined by their phenomenal top quality, distinct tastes, and thorough preparation approaches. These blends often originate from solitary ranches or areas, showcasing the distinct features of their terroir.


Among the characteristics of specialized coffees is the emphasis on single-origin beans, which enable coffee connoisseurs to experience the nuanced taste accounts that occur from particular expanding conditions. As an example, Ethiopian coffees might offer intense level of acidity with floral notes, while Colombian selections normally present a well balanced sweetness. Roasters typically try out blending beans from various beginnings to create unified tastes that Check Out Your URL highlight the strengths of each element.


Furthermore, the craft of roasting plays a crucial role in boosting the coffee's unique characteristics. Light roasts can accentuate floral and fruity notes, while medium and dark roasts may highlight chocolatey or nutty touches. As the specialty coffee market remains to expand, lovers are increasingly attracted to limited-edition blends, additionally improving the tapestry of tastes offered to them. Eventually, specialized coffees represent an event of quality and imagination within the coffee sector.
